The Russische buurt

The Russische buurt is a densely built urban area with a mix of old and new housing. Two residents have reviewed the neighbourhood, giving it an average score of 5.69 out of 10. One resident says: "This neighbourhood is deteriorating; people are increasingly less willing to keep their own street clean. And from the municipality you can expect absolutely nothing." Another adds: "It's not really safe in the neighbourhood in the evenings. When there has been a market, it often takes another day before it's cleaned up." The area has a high population density and a young demographic, with many single-person households. For more details, see the neighbourhood Russische buurt.

Is €1,535 a fair price for this apartment?

The rent of €1,535 is close to the neighbourhood average of €1,567 and the median of €1,480. With 71 m², the price per square metre (€21.62) is below the neighbourhood average of €24.49, so it represents good value for the size.

How far is the train station?

Zaandam train station is 0.9 km away, about a ten-minute walk. From there you can reach Amsterdam in around 15 minutes.
